One of the biggest misconceptions about recruitment is that you should only start looking for people when you have a vacancy. In reality, the most successful teams are always 'warm' to the market. An effective applicant tracking system Australia allows you to build and nurture talent pools long before a role is officially advertised. This proactive approach means that when a position does open up, you aren't starting from scratch.
Instead of posting a generic ad and hoping for the best, you can reach out to individuals who have already expressed interest in your brand. This reduces your reliance on expensive job boards and helps you maintain a consistent pipeline of talent. However, a talent pool is only useful if the data inside it is searchable and structured. You need to be able to filter by skills, experience, and – most importantly – how well they might fit into your specific team dynamic.
We often see recruiters struggle to manage these relationships because they lack a central source of truth. By centralising these interactions, you ensure that every touchpoint a candidate has with your brand is recorded. This prevents the embarrassing situation where two different managers reach out to the same person with conflicting messages. It creates a professional, unified front that respects the candidate's time and interest.

There is a common fear that introducing an applicant tracking system Australia will make the hiring process feel cold or robotic. In fact, the opposite is true. When we automate the 'robotic' parts of the job – like sending confirmation emails, moving candidates between stages, or scheduling initial screenings – we free up your recruiters to do the 'human' parts of the job. It gives them back the time to actually talk to people, answer questions, and build rapport.
Automation ensures that no candidate ever falls through the cracks. We have all heard stories of 'ghosting' in recruitment, where a candidate never hears back after an interview. Usually, this isn't because the recruiter is rude; it's because they are overwhelmed. A good system handles those notifications automatically, ensuring every person who interacts with your company receives a polite and timely response. This protects your employer brand and ensures you don't burn bridges with talent you might want to hire in the future.
Consider the workflow of a typical hiring manager. They need to coordinate with HR, review scores, check references, and manage their own calendar. An integrated system simplifies this by providing a single dashboard where all feedback is centralised. You can see at a glance where every candidate stands, what the interviewers thought, and what the next step should be. This transparency eliminates the 'black hole' of recruitment and keeps the process moving at a pace that keeps candidates engaged.
For senior leadership, the real power of an applicant tracking system Australia lies in the data it generates. You can finally answer questions like: Where are our best candidates coming from? Which stage of our process is taking too long? Why are we losing candidates at the final offer stage? This level of insight allows you to treat recruitment like any other critical business function – with measurable goals and continuous improvement.
If you find that your time-to-hire is significantly higher than the industry average, you can dive into the data to find the bottleneck. Perhaps your background checks are taking too long, or maybe there is a delay in getting feedback from department heads. Once you identify the problem, you can fix it. Without a system in place, you are just guessing. Data-driven recruitment allows you to justify your budget, prove the ROI of your hiring efforts, and align your talent strategy with your overall business objectives.
